The Wac Arts Schools and Communities team is looking for an experienced workshop leader to join their pool of Performing Arts Facilitators working across schools and community settings in Camden and the surrounding areas. You will plan and deliver a weekly after-school project for a group of children in reception class, exploring storytelling and character through drama, music and movement. The children and young people taking part will develop their performance technique and collaboration skills and work towards an informal sharing of their work.
Wac Arts provides select equipment for use in these sessions. You will also receive support and guidance from the Schools and Communities team.
Wac Arts Schools and Communities Facilitators are paid £45.00 per hour. These rates are subject to deductions for tax and national insurance as appropriate. Sessional Tutors are paid in arrears, at monthly intervals directly into your bank account for work completed in the previous assignment(s).
